Am I doing something wrong when I close the hood. Sometimes I will close it and one side will rub against the headlight and sometimes it has about a 3/4 inch gap between the hood and the headlight. Whats the deal?
What is the "proper" technique for closing the hood?
You can't say that without knowing how that particular hood is adjusted. I've seen latched hoods with a 1" gap (and yes, clearly the latch needs to be adjusted).When there is a 3/4 gap, the hood isn't latched.
I feel it's always best, when trying to make this adjustment, to remove the front facia. I've done this several time on my 96 and got it looking near perfect, but set aside a day to dicker with it. The headlights can be moved in all directions(at least with mine) and are move vertically with shims. In my case, I move the headlight forward and to the outside of the car ot make it look correct. Good luck and you'll find if you do remove the facia, there are a couple of push pins best not replaced if you think you might go back in at a later date.Headlights have a very slight horizontal adjustment. Most of the adjustment is fore and aft. there are four bolts and with a little stretch armstrong like wiggling, you can adjust through the foglight hole. It is also helpful to remove the rubber "plug" from in front of the tire to have two access/light points to reach inside.
